Choose between these IQ Riddles

  • What has keys but can’t open locks? – A piano.
  • I speak without a mouth and hear without ears. I have no body, but I come alive with the wind. What am I? – An echo.
  • The more you take, the more you leave behind. What am I? – Footsteps.
  • What has a heart that doesn’t beat? – A deck of cards.
  • I am taken from a mine, and shut up in a wooden case, from which I am never released, and yet I am used by almost every person. What am I? – Pencil lead.
  • I am always hungry, I must always be fed. The finger I touch will soon turn red. What am I? – Fire.
  • I am full of holes but still holds water. What am I? – A sponge.
  • I have cities but no houses, forests but no trees, and rivers but no water. What am I? – A map.
  • What has to be broken before you can use it? – An egg.
  • What comes once in a minute, twice in a moment, but never in a thousand years? – The letter “M”.
  • What has a face and two hands but no arms or legs? – A clock.
  • I am an odd number. Take away a letter and I become even. What number am I? – Seven.
  • What has a thumb and four fingers but is not alive? – A glove.
  • I am an instrument you can hear, but you cannot touch or see me. What am I? – Your voice.
  • I can fly without wings, cry without eyes, and whistle without a mouth. What am I? – The wind.
